How good can management be? Dr. King told sanitation workers: "If a man is called to be a streetsweeper, he should sweep streets even as Michelangelo painted, or Beethoven composed music, or Shakespeare wrote poetry. He should sweep streets so well that all the host of heaven and earth will pause to say, here lived a great streetsweeper who did his job well." Can a leader be an artist? Is there the possibility of music or poetry in how we manage? We played with that idea and produced this short video. How good can management be in American Healthcare? The answer is up to you.
